Understanding the Core Principles That Define Effective Website Design in the Modern Era
Effective website design is built upon several foundational principles that work together to create meaningful user experiences. These principles include clarity, consistency, usability, accessibility, responsiveness, and visual hierarchy.
Clarity ensures that visitors immediately understand the purpose of a website. Every design element should contribute to a clear message and avoid unnecessary distractions. When users can quickly identify what a website offers, they are more likely to remain engaged and explore further.
Consistency creates familiarity and strengthens brand identity. Consistent typography, colors, navigation structures, and visual elements help users feel comfortable as they move through different sections of a website. This predictability reduces confusion and improves overall usability.
Usability focuses on making websites easy to navigate and interact with. Visitors should be able to find information quickly and complete tasks efficiently. Intuitive navigation menus, logical page structures, and clear calls to action contribute to a positive user experience.
Accessibility ensures that websites can be used by individuals with diverse abilities. Inclusive design practices make digital content available to a broader audience while demonstrating social responsibility and compliance with accessibility standards.
The Historical Journey of Website Design from Basic Web Pages to Immersive Digital Experiences
The early days of website design were characterized by simplicity and technical limitations. Websites primarily consisted of plain text, basic hyperlinks, and minimal visual elements. Functionality was prioritized over aesthetics because internet speeds and browser capabilities were limited.
As web technologies advanced, designers gained greater creative freedom. The introduction of images, tables, and improved styling options allowed websites to become more visually engaging. Businesses began recognizing the internet as a valuable marketing platform, leading to increased investment in design and user experience.
The rise of cascading style sheets revolutionized website design by separating content from presentation. This innovation provided greater control over layouts, typography, and visual consistency. Designers could create more sophisticated interfaces while maintaining cleaner code structures.
The emergence of responsive design marked another significant milestone. With the growing popularity of smartphones and tablets, websites needed to function seamlessly across various screen sizes. Responsive design techniques enabled websites to adapt dynamically, ensuring optimal viewing experiences regardless of device.
Today, website design incorporates advanced animations, interactive elements, artificial intelligence integrations, and immersive multimedia experiences. Modern websites combine functionality with aesthetics to create engaging digital environments that captivate users and encourage meaningful interactions.
The Essential Role of Visual Hierarchy in Guiding User Attention and Enhancing Engagement
Visual hierarchy is one of the most important concepts in website design. It refers to the arrangement of elements in a way that directs users toward the most important information first.
Designers use size, color, contrast, spacing, and positioning to establish visual priorities. Headlines are typically larger than body text, making them more noticeable. Important buttons often feature contrasting colors that draw attention and encourage interaction.
Whitespace plays a critical role in visual hierarchy. By providing breathing room between elements, designers can emphasize key content and improve readability. Proper spacing prevents overcrowding and creates a more organized appearance.
Strategic use of visual hierarchy helps users scan content efficiently. Since many visitors do not read every word on a page, designers must structure information to support quick comprehension and effortless navigation.
Typography as a Powerful Design Element That Shapes Communication and Brand Identity
Typography influences how users perceive information and interact with content. The choice of fonts, sizes, spacing, and alignment affects readability, emotional impact, and overall user experience.
Professional website design often combines multiple typefaces to create visual contrast while maintaining consistency. Headlines may use bold, distinctive fonts, while body text prioritizes readability and comfort during extended reading sessions.
Proper line spacing and paragraph structure improve comprehension by reducing visual fatigue. Well-designed typography creates a pleasant reading experience that encourages visitors to spend more time engaging with content.
Typography also contributes significantly to brand personality. Elegant fonts may communicate sophistication, while modern sans-serif fonts often convey innovation and simplicity. Through thoughtful typographic choices, designers can reinforce brand values and establish stronger emotional connections with audiences.
The Strategic Use of Color Psychology to Influence User Perception and Behavior
Color is a powerful communication tool in website design. Different colors evoke different emotions, associations, and responses. Understanding color psychology allows designers to create experiences that align with brand objectives and user expectations.
Blue is often associated with trust, professionalism, and reliability. Many corporate and technology websites utilize blue to establish credibility. Green frequently represents growth, sustainability, and wellness. Red can create urgency, excitement, and energy, making it effective for promotional campaigns and calls to action.
Successful color schemes balance aesthetics with functionality. Sufficient contrast improves readability, while harmonious color combinations create visually pleasing experiences. Consistent color usage strengthens brand recognition and supports cohesive design systems.
Designers must also consider cultural interpretations of color, as meanings can vary across different regions and audiences. Thoughtful color selection enhances communication and contributes to more effective digital experiences.
Responsive Website Design as the Foundation of Modern User Experiences Across Multiple Devices
The modern internet landscape includes smartphones, tablets, laptops, desktops, smart televisions, and other connected devices. Responsive website design ensures that content remains accessible and visually appealing regardless of screen size.
Responsive design relies on flexible grids, scalable images, and adaptive layouts. Instead of creating separate websites for different devices, designers develop systems that adjust automatically based on available screen space.
This approach improves user satisfaction by providing consistent experiences across devices. Visitors can begin browsing on a smartphone and continue on a desktop without encountering significant usability issues.
Search engines also favor mobile-friendly websites, making responsive design an important factor in digital visibility and long-term online success.
